Venue Decoration Ideas

Changing a new home into a inviting venue for a housewarming event doesn’t need to be overwhelming. For lively touches, consider a mix of personal and seasonal decorations. A straightforward yet effective idea is draping string lights across a living space, which can create an welcoming ambiance. Fresh flowers in unique vases add a splash of color and life.

Creating a photo wall with memories from the past or even blank frames encourages guests to share their stories. Don’t forget about scents; scented candles or simmer pots with spices can make the space feel comfortable. One host recalled how her guests complimented the décor, sparking significant conversations.     Refreshments and Snack Ideas

    As guests arrive, the right refreshments can truly set the tone for a unforgettable housewarming event. Offering a variety of snacks can keep everyone mingling and enjoying themselves. Picture a charming cheese board, laden with tangy cheddar and smooth brie, surrounded by an array of crackers and fresh fruits; it’s always a hit. Adding a few easy bites like savory meat skewers or stuffed mini-bell peppers can enhance the experience. For sweet options, chocolate-covered strawberries or bite-sized pastries bring a touch of sophistication. And don’t forget beverages! A special cocktail alongside soda and sparkling water caters to all tastes. Remember, thoughtful refreshments create a inviting atmosphere, encouraging guests to kick back, and make lasting memories.
